General Calcioaravaipaite Information

Help on Chemical  Formula: Chemical Formula: PbCa2Al(F,OH)9
Help on Composition: Composition: Molecular Weight = 483.33 gm
   Calcium   16.58 %  Ca   23.20 % CaO
   Aluminum   5.58 %  Al   10.55 % Al2O3
   Hydrogen   0.21 %  H     1.86 % H2O
   Lead      42.87 %  Pb   46.18 % PbO
   Oxygen     3.31 %  O
   Fluorine  31.45 %  F    31.45 % F
               -   %  F   -13.24 % -O=F2
            ______        ______ 
            100.00 %      100.00 % = TOTAL OXIDE
Help on Empirical Formula: Empirical Formula: PbCa2AlF8(OH)
Help on Environment: Environment: In a small epithermal lead-copper-silver deposit in a silicified breccia.
Help on IMA Status: IMA Status: Approved IMA 1996 (Dana # Added)
Help on Locality: Locality: The Grand Reef mine in Laurel Canyon, about 6 km northeast of Klondyke, Aravaipa mining district, Graham County, Arizona. USA. Link to MinDat.org Location Data.
Help on Name Origin: Name Origin: For the relationship with aravaipaite
Help on Synonym: Synonym: IMA1994-018

Calcioaravaipaite Crystallography

Help on Axial Ratios: Axial Ratios: a:b:c =1.0274:1:1.624
Help on Cell Dimensions: Cell Dimensions: a = 7.722, b = 7.516, c = 12.206, Z = 4; alpha = 98.86°, beta = 96.91°, gamma = 90° V = 694.88 Den(Calc)= 4.62
Help on Crystal System: Crystal System: Triclinic - PinacoidalH-M Symbol ( 1) Space Group: C1
Help on X Ray Diffraction: X Ray Diffraction: By Intensity(I/Io): 11.9(1), 3.81(0.85), 3.71(0.7),2.981(0.6),

Kampf A R , Merlino S , Pasero M , American Mineralogist , 88 (2003) p.430-435, Order-disorder approach to calcioaravaipaite, [PbCa2Al(F,OH)9]:, The crystal structure of the triclinic MDO polytype

 

Physical Properties of Calcioaravaipaite

Help on Cleavage: Cleavage: [100] Good
Help on Color: Color: Colorless, Milk white.
Help on Density: Density: 4.85
Help on Diaphaniety: Diaphaniety: Transparent
Help on Fracture: Fracture: Brittle - Conchoidal - Very brittle fracture producing small, conchoidal fragments.
Help on Habit: Habit: Crystalline - Fine - Occurs as well-formed fine sized crystals.
Help on Habit: Habit: Massive - Uniformly indistinguishable crystals forming large masses.
Help on Hardness: Hardness: 2.5 - Finger Nail
Help on Luster: Luster: Vitreous (Glassy)
Help on Streak: Streak: white
 

Optical Properties of Calcioaravaipaite

Help on Gladstone-Dale: Gladstone-Dale: CI meas= 0.296 (Poor) - where the CI = (1-KPDmeas/KC)
CI calc= 0.261 (Poor) - where the CI = (1-KPDcalc/KC)
KPDcalc= 0.1132,KPDmeas= 0.1078,KC= 0.1531
Help on Optical Data: Optical Data: Biaxial (-), a=1.51, b=1.528, g=1.531, bire=0.0210, 2V(Calc)=44, 2V(Meas)=36. Dispersion r > v strong.

Calcioaravaipaite Classification

Help on  Dana Class: Dana Class: 11.6.22.1 (11)Halide Complexes; Alumino-fluorides
  (11.6)with miscellaneous formulae
  (11.6.22)Dana Group
 
11.6.22.1 Calcioaravaipaite ! PbCa2Al(F,OH)9 C1 1
Help on  Strunz Class: Strunz Class: III/C.04-20 III - Halogenides
  III/C - Double halogenides with water, Fluorides
  III/C.04 - Aravaipaite - Calcioaravaipaite series
 
III/C.04-10 Aravaipaite Pb3AlF9·(H2O) P 21/m 2/m
 
III/C.04-20 Calcioaravaipaite PbCa2Al(F,OH)9 C1 1
